Initial winding stress in wire given compressive circumferential stress exerted by wire evaluator uses Initial Winding Stress = (Compressive Circumferential Stress*(4*Thickness Of Wire))/(pi*Diameter of Wire) to evaluate the Initial Winding Stress, The Initial winding stress in wire given compressive circumferential stress exerted by wire formula is defined as the elongation of the material when a stretching force is applied along with the axis of applied force. Initial Winding Stress is denoted by σw symbol.
